Bug ID: 420338 Summary: [selection] Krita can't paint (empty selection, feedback issue) Product: krita Version: 4.2.9 Platform: Other OS: Linux Status: REPORTED Severity: major Priority: NOR Component: Tools/Selection Assignee: krita-bugs-n...@kde.org Reporter: i...@davidrevoy.com Target Milestone: --- Hey, After visiting forums, blaming Windows driver of its XP-Pen tablet, checking the property of all layers, a user sent me this morning a Krita document that he couldn't paint on it anymore. Not possible to paint on any layers. The solution was simple but not obvious. And this bug could be a good prank to a co-worker using Krita 4.2.9. :D To reproduce: ============= - Open a new multilayered document. - Ctrl+A: Select all (notice the marching ant all around the canvas) - Ctrl+Shift+i: Invert selection... (Tadaaaa! Marching ants disapear totally) - Save now the document as *.kra, close it, reopen it, share it. Result: ======= It produce a invisble empty selection. So no feedback about the presence of selection: the canvas appears totally normal, no marching ant. Exept you can't paint on this document anymore nor apply filters. And this affect all layers. Workaround: Menu → Select → Deselect all (nothing visually happens, but it unlock all). The user who sent this to me thought his artwork was just frozen this way. Expected: ========= If possible, a marching ant path around the canvas, even after inverting the selection. -- You are receiving this mail because: You are watching all bug changes.
